When businesses need a dependable and versatile solution for transportation, look no further than the SEWA Mercedes Sprinter. This powerful van is built to handle a variety of tasks, making it the perfect choice for https://maeilds806163.estate-blog.com/35744890/our-reliable-transportation-partner